oraz wszystko, co mym zdaniem, związek ma z programowaniem
Posts tagged co ja pacze
Jak zhakować dziesiątki osób? Poznaj „Jeden hakerski sposób”.
28-01-2015
przez PaSkol
w Refleksyjnie
Zapewne widzieliście już prezentację Erika Meijera z Reaktor Dev Day 2014. Prelegent postanowił rozprawić się z całą tą ściemą, jaką jest Agile, a jako jej alternatywę zaprezentował podejście „One Hacker Way” – nieskomplikowane, bo sprowadzającą się prostu do … pisania kodu. Ilu z Was łyknęło tę [...]
Za stres, absurdy, bezkres mordęgi słusznie należy się pieniądz tęgi
08-07-2014
przez PaSkol
w Refleksyjnie
Mamy sezon ogórkowy, słoneczko przygrzewa, klimatyzacja ledwo dyszy z każdej dyszy, zarząd i kadra średniego szczebla udała się na zasłużony odpoczynek i tylko pasjonaci wolą spędzać ten czas w pracy. Ci pasjonaci to my. W tych ekstremalnych okolicznościach przyrody nie sądzę abyście chcieli [...]
Bacz, bo w gąszczu uogólnień – skryty – rwie uproszczeń strumień.
31-12-2013
Zgodnie z obietnicą wypada przedstawić drugi z rezultatów inspiracji wynikłej ze swoistego dialogu (diaBlogu ;)) pomiędzy Krzysztofem Morcinkiem a mną. Tym razem skupię się na następującym fragmencie jego wpisu:
(problemem – przyp. mój) może być, gdy zwiążemy wspólnym kodem zupełnie różne miejsca [...]
Siekierka służy na wyrębach. Nie służy do dłubania w zębach.
Swojego czasu zachwalałem wytrawność kodu i zapraszałem do jego degustacji. Pocieszające jest, że nikt z tego powodu nie był zdegustowany, a wręcz przeciwnie – niektórych zainspirowałem. Nie ukrywam, że lubię być inspiracją ;), a już uwielbiam, kiedy wynikiem tejże inspiracji jest z kolei [...]
Jakie mogą mieć korzyści z psychologii programiści?
30-09-2013
przez PaSkol
w Refleksyjnie
Jeżeli po przeczytaniu tytułu tego wpisu masz mieszane uczucia, bo niby co wspólnego może mieć psychologia z programowaniem, to zanim postanowisz zrezygnować z dalszej lektury, przypomnij sobie o wzorcach projektowych, a dokładnie skąd się one wzięły. Tak, początkowo to nie był pomysł programisty, [...]
Bibliotekom – zasadniczo – nie pomaga tajemniczość (o dezinformacji w temacie relacji)
W ADO.NET jest coś takiego jak możliwość ustanowienia relacji pomiędzy dwiema tabelami, a następnie prezentacja tabeli zależnej z kontekście nadrzędnej. Można to zrealizować np. tak:
Jest to kod aplikacji WinForms. Ostatnie dwie instrukcje metody button1_Click umożliwiają wskazanie danych, które [...]
Interfejs (chciałbym sprostować), to nie jest klasa bazowa
W zeszłym tygodniu na dotNETomaniaku wypromowano artykuł na temat interfejsów. Zapoznałem się z nim i odnoszę wrażenie, że autor nie rozumie w pełni roli interfejsu i myli go z klasą bazową. O taką pomyłkę rzeczywiście nietrudno, wiele klas buduje bowiem swoją funkcjonalność na podstawie [...]
Na dwa rodzaje metod rozbita klasa: poleceń oraz zapytań.
Postanowiłem poruszyć kwestię zasady oddzielania poleceń od zapytań. Pisał o niej ostatnio Piotr Zieliński. Cóż to takiego te „polecenia” i „zapytania”? Ujmując to zagadnienie bardzo ogólnie można powiedzieć, że cechy charakteryzujące klasę dzielą się na polecenia i zapytania. Pierwsze z nich służą [...]
Co jest zasadnym powodem, by przekabacić metodę
Piotr Zieliński na swoim blogu rozważał zasadność redefiniowania przez klasy dziedziczące metod z klas dziedziczonych (przy pomocy modyfikatora new), warto zapoznać się z tym wpisem przed kontynuowaniem lektury niniejszego tekstu. Na zakończenie Piotr poprosił o podanie innych, od przestawionych [...]
Cni Panowie, zacne Panie: polimorfizm – sprostowanie.
Jak wspominałem we wpisie inaugurującym działanie tego bloga, jestem w trakcie wzbogacania swoich umiejętności programistycznych o język C#. W tym celu przeglądam m.in. różne materiały w sieci, czy to artykuły na MSDN, czy to blogi, czy też różne kursy video. Jednym z takich kursów jest [...]